    چکیده
    Wireless sensor networks are composed of very small devices, called sensor nodes,for numerous applications in the environment. In adversarial environments, the securitybecomes a crucial issue in wireless sensor networks (WSNs). There are various securityservices in WSNs such as key management, authentication, and pairwise keyestablishment. Due to some limitations on sensor nodes, the previous key establishmenttechniques are unsuitable for WSNs. To overcome these problems, researchers proposeseveral key pre-distribution schemes. Our proposed approach uses a combinatorialframework in the hypercube-based (HB) scheme to pre-distribute keys to each sensornode. By this way, the number of common keys between two nodes in a wirelesscommunication range increases. Therefore, the level of security in terms of resilienceagainst node capture attack and the probability of re-establishing an indirect key will beimproved.
